UAE- FoCP receives Dh158000 for cancer projects


(MENAFN- Khaleej Times) The friends of cancer patients (focp) society received a donation of dh158000 from the islamic affairs and charitable activities department (iacad) during the department?s participation in the dubai international humanitarian aid and development conference (dihad) 2014.

the funds will help support various cancer-related projects such as early detection treatment and awareness campaigns for different types of cancers.

dr sawsan al madhi secretary-general of the focp accepted the donation from dr hamad al shaibani director-general of the iacad in the presence of ibrahim abu malhah cultural advisor to his highness shaikh mohammed bin rashid al maktoum vice-president and prime minister of the uae and ruler of dubai and ali al mansouri head of charitable institutions department.

the department has supported 30 events held by the society with a total value exceeding dh3 million over the past three years.

the society has launched a number of initiatives for the early diagnosis of cancer including breast cervical skin and prostate cancer among others. — news?khaleejtimes.com
